Proper and Improper Complex Waves of a Circular Two-Layer Screened Waveguide with an Axial Longitudinally Magnetized Ferrite Layer

In a two-layer circular screened waveguide with a longitudinally magnetized inner ferrite layer, the presence of different types of complex waves (CWs) both satisfying and not satisfying the energetic orthogonality condition is shown. The CWs are the solutions of a homogeneous boundary value problem, but, in the first case, the waves are energetically independent and, in the second case, they are associated with the source and indirectly coupled through it.
